class MessageTests(unittest.TestCase): DECODE_FILE = os.path.join(DECODING_FILES_PATH, 'message.json') def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s): unittest.TestCase.__init__(self, *args, **kwargs) self.api = TelegramAPy(TELEGRAM_TOKEN) @unittest.skipIf(not SEND_MESSAGES, 'Sending messages skipped') def test_simple_message(self): """Does it send messages correctly?""" msg = self.api.sendMessage(TEST_CHAT_ID, "test_simple_message") self.assertIsInstance(msg, Message) @unittest.skipIf(not SEND_MESSAGES, 'Sending messages skipped') def test_markdown_message(self): """Does it send messages with markdown correctly?""" msg = self.api.sendMessage(TEST_CHAT_ID, "*test_markdown_message*", parse_mode=TelegramAPy.MARKDOWN_MODE) self.assertIsInstance(msg, Message) def test_message_decode(self): with open(MessageTests.DECODE_FILE) as json_file: j = json.load(json_file) obj = Message.decode(j) self.assertEqual(obj.message_id, j[Message.FIELD_MESSAGEID]) self.assertEqual(obj.text, j[Message.FIELD_TEXT]) self.assertIsInstance(obj.date, datetime.datetime) self.assertIsInstance(obj.from_, User) self.assertIsInstance(obj.chat, Chat) self.assertIsInstance(obj.forward_from, User) self.assertIsInstance(obj.reply_to_message, Message)
class GeneralTests(unittest.TestCase): def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s): super(GeneralTests, self).__init__(*args, **kwargs) self.api = TelegramAPy(TELEGRAM_TOKEN) def test_token(self): """Does work with correct token?""" self.api.getMe() def test_invalid_token(self): """Does raise exception with invalid token?""" with self.assertRaises(InvalidTokenException): TelegramAPy("wrongtoken") def test_wrong_token(self): """Does raise exception with invalid token?""" w_api = TelegramAPy("123456:ABC-DEF1234ghIkl-zyx57W2v1u123ew11") with self.assertRaises(TelegramException): w_api.getMe()
class UpdatesTests(unittest.TestCase): DECODE_FILE = os.path.join(DECODING_FILES_PATH, 'update.json') def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s): unittest.TestCase.__init__(self, *args, **kwargs) self.api = TelegramAPy(TELEGRAM_TOKEN) def test_get_updates(self): upds = self.api.getUpdates() if upds: for upd in upds: self.assertIsInstance(upd, Update) else: self.skip("No updates recieved.") def test_update_decode(self): with open(UpdatesTests.DECODE_FILE) as json_file: j = json.load(json_file) obj = Update.decode(j) self.assertEqual(obj.update_id, j[Update.FIELD_UPDATEID]) self.assertIsInstance(obj.message, Message)
